Advertisement

Renminwang-Message-Crawler-2最新版.rar

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
这是一款用于爬取“人民网”网站消息内容的软件工具包(Renminwang-Message-Crawler-2最新版),方便用户收集和分析新闻资讯数据。 这段文字配合相关代码和数据使用,可以用于测试和交流学习目的,请勿滥用,否则后果自负。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Renminwang-Message-Crawler-2.rar
    优质
    这是一款用于爬取“人民网”网站消息内容的软件工具包(Renminwang-Message-Crawler-2最新版),方便用户收集和分析新闻资讯数据。 这段文字配合相关代码和数据使用,可以用于测试和交流学习目的,请勿滥用,否则后果自负。
  • Renminwang-Messages-Crawler-3.rar
    优质
    Renminwang-Messages-Crawler-3 是一个用于爬取人民网消息数据的软件工具包,版本为3,适用于研究和数据分析。 在互联网开发领域,数据抓取是一项重要的技能,在数据分析、网站维护以及研究工作中发挥着关键作用。“Renminwang-Message-Crawler-3”项目提供了一种使用Python编写的留言板留言爬虫代码示例,并结合了Selenium模拟浏览器行为的技术,实现了对网页留言信息的高效采集。下面将详细解析该项目中的核心知识点。 项目的主体是基于Python编程语言开发的。由于其简洁清晰的语法和强大的库支持,Python成为了数据处理与网络抓取的理想选择。在这个项目中,利用Python编写爬虫程序来发送HTTP请求、分析HTML页面,并保存所获取的数据。 在大规模数据采集场景下,“多进程版”标签强调了提高效率的重要性。单线程环境下的性能瓶颈主要体现在全局解释器锁(GIL)的限制上。为了克服这一挑战,项目采用了Python内置的multiprocessing模块来创建多个独立运行的工作进程,从而显著加快爬虫的速度并优化整体性能。 Selenium是一个强大的Web自动化测试工具,它允许开发者模拟真实用户的操作行为如点击、滚动和填写表单等动作。在本案例中,Selenium主要用于应对涉及JavaScript动态加载内容的登录及交互场景,并帮助绕过一些网站设置的反爬机制以获取实时更新的数据。 具体实现步骤包括: 1. **初始化Selenium**:通过创建WebDriver实例(例如ChromeDriver)并配置启动参数来开始。 2. **模拟登录过程**:使用填写用户名和密码的方式,模拟用户点击提交按钮,并捕获登录后的cookies信息。 3. **处理动态加载内容**:考虑到页面可能采用AJAX技术实现异步数据加载,Selenium等待特定元素的出现以确保所有需要的数据已经完全载入。 4. **抓取留言信息**:解析HTML文档结构,定位至指定区域并提取每条留言的相关详情(例如用户名、时间戳和内容)。 5. **利用多进程技术提高效率**:将任务分配给多个独立运行的子程序处理不同部分的数据采集工作。 6. **数据保存机制**:最后将收集到的信息存储于文件系统中,如CSV格式或数据库内,以便后续进一步分析使用。 值得注意的是,“Renminwang-Message-Crawler-3”项目强调了测试和学习交流的目的性。因此,在实际应用时可能需要根据具体网页结构做出相应调整,并且使用者应当遵守网络伦理规范以避免侵犯他人隐私权或者违反相关法律法规。“Renminwang-Message-Crawler-3”展示了Python在构建高效爬虫程序方面的强大能力,结合多进程技术和Selenium模拟操作功能为学习者提供了一个宝贵的实践案例。通过深入研究和实际应用该项目,开发者可以增强自身对于Python编程、网络抓取以及Web自动化测试的理解与掌握程度。
  • course-crawler-.zip
    优质
    course-crawler-最新版.zip是一款用于自动抓取课程信息的软件工具包,帮助用户高效收集和整理网络课程资源。 一个基于 Python 3 的 MOOC 课程爬虫可以获取中国大学MOOC、学堂在线和网易云课堂的免费课程,方便离线观看。从中国大学MOOC和网易云课堂可以获得视频、富文本、附件和字幕;而学堂在线则提供视频、电子书和字幕。
  • IEC 62133-2-2021 中文本.rar
    优质
    该文档为IEC 62133-2-2021标准的最新中文版,提供了便携式密封二次锂电池及金属聚合物电池的安全要求和测试方法。 《IEC 62133-2-2021标准详解》 IEC 62133-2-2021是由国际电工委员会(International Electrotechnical Commission,简称IEC)发布的一项关于便携式密封二次电池及电池组安全要求的重要标准。此标准旨在确保这些产品的安全性,在正常使用和异常情况下防止可能的危害,如火灾、爆炸等。在最新版本中,标准进一步细化了对设计、制造、测试以及性能的要求,以适应不断发展的技术和市场环境。 《IEC 62133-2-2021最新中文版》详细规定了电池安全的各个方面: 1. **安全设计与构造**:包括物理结构、电气隔离和热管理等要求。例如,外壳材料选择、内部短路防护机制及过充保护电路的设计,以减少潜在的安全风险。 2. **性能测试**:标准设定了耐压、耐热性、振动性和冲击性的测试方法,用于验证电池在各种条件下的稳定性。 3. **滥用测试**:该部分涵盖了过充电、过放电、短路和跌落等极端情况的模拟试验,以评估电池的安全性。 4. **环境保护**:标准还关注了有害物质限制以及可回收性等问题,体现了环保意识的重要性。 5. **标记与说明书**:要求电池及其组具有清晰标识,并提供正确的使用说明及储存、处置指南,避免因误用导致的风险问题。 压缩包内可能包含一键改名的批处理文件和指导如何查看标准文档的方法文本。IEC 62133-2-2021为制造商提供了明确的设计与测试准则,并且对消费者和监管机构来说也是衡量产品安全性的依据,尤其在电动汽车及储能系统等领域的高安全性要求下显得尤为重要。 因此,《IEC 62133-2-2021》对于电池行业的研发、生产和应用企业都具有重要的指导意义。
  • HTTP/2 2.8.1
    优质
    HTTP/2最新版2.8.1提供了性能优化和错误修复,增强了协议的安全性和稳定性,进一步提升了网站加载速度和用户体验。 如果你需要一个现成的插件来支持通过 HTTP/2 实现 REST、WebSocket、Socket.IO、SignalR、SignalR Core、Server-Sent Events(以及更多)的自定义请求,并且该插件具有开发者定期更新和出色的技术支持,那么 BestHTTP/2 是你的理想选择。这个工具非常适合那些希望简化网络通信并保持最新技术标准的应用程序开发人员使用。
  • ISO 15765-2:2016
    优质
    ISO 15765-2:2016是国际标准化组织发布的关于道路车辆车载网络系统的标准第二部分,规定了控制器局域网(CAN)的数据传输格式和诊断通信协议。 ISO 15765-2 2016最新版本的
  • ISO 7637-2和16750-2
    优质
    本文介绍了ISO 7637-2和ISO 16750-2的最新标准版本,深入解析了两个标准的更新内容及其在车辆电气系统中的应用。 ISO 7637-2 和 ISO 16750-2 的最新版本与国标 GB/T 21437 相对应,本段落将对这些标准的最新内容进行解读,并对比分析其与旧版之间的差异。
  • AutoPanoGiga 3.5 (2014-2-27)
    优质
    AutoPanoGiga 3.5是2014年发布的专业全景图制作软件最新版本,提供强大的图像拼接和编辑功能,适用于摄影师和地图制作者。 AutoPanoGiga 3.5(2014年2月27日最新版)是一款卓越的全景图片缝合工具,堪称全球最佳,无可比拟。
  • RSA-Tool 2.rar
    优质
    RSA-Tool 2更新版是一款针对RSA算法进行学习和实验的软件工具包最新版本。该更新包含功能优化、安全修复及性能增强,旨在为用户提供更佳的学习体验与实验环境。 RSA算法是一种非对称加密技术,在1977年由Ron Rivest、Adi Shamir和Leonard Adleman提出并以其名字命名。它在信息安全领域中扮演着至关重要的角色,广泛应用于数据加密、数字签名以及密钥交换等领域。 在一个名为“RSA-Tool 2.rar”的压缩包内,可能包含了一个用于实现RSA算法的工具或库。该工具的核心原理基于大数因子分解问题的复杂性。其主要组成部分包括两个密钥:公钥和私钥。其中,公钥可以公开使用以加密信息;而私钥必须严格保密,用于解密已加密的信息。 具体来说: 1. 选择两个大的素数p和q,并计算它们的乘积n=p*q。 2. 计算欧拉函数φ(n)=(p-1)*(q-1)。 3. 然后选取一个与φ(n)互质的整数e,作为公钥的一部分。 4. 寻找满足条件d*e ≡ 1 (mod φ(n))且介于1和φ(n)-1之间的整数d,用于构成私钥的一部分。 在实际应用中: - 公钥(e, n)被用来加密数据。 - 私钥(d, n)则负责解密由公钥加密的数据。 此外,RSA算法不仅限于简单的数据加密与解密。它还广泛应用于数字签名和安全的密钥交换过程。 在“RSA-Tool 2”这个工具中可能包括的功能有: 1. RSA密钥生成:自动创建大素数p和q,并据此计算出公私两把钥匙。 2. 加密及解密操作:提供用户界面进行加密或解密,支持明文或者密文输入输出。 3. 数字签名与验证功能:使用私钥对信息的哈希值进行数字签名,同时利用相应的公钥来检验该签名的有效性以确保数据完整性。 4. 安全地交换双方所需的公钥,并通过此过程建立共享秘密用于后续加密通信。 这款工具简化了RSA算法的实际操作步骤,使得使用者无需手动执行复杂的数学运算。它对于学习和理解RSA技术以及在实际项目中的应用都非常有用。然而,在使用过程中需要注意妥善管理密钥以防止私钥泄漏带来的安全风险。由于直接使用RSA进行大量数据的加密效率较低,通常建议将其用于保护对称密钥或小规模的数据传输场景中。
  • ODAC12C_x64.rar
    优质
    ODAC12C_x64最新版.rar是一款针对Oracle数据库开发的应用程序接口(ODAC)软件包,专为64位系统设计,提供最新的功能和改进,帮助开发者高效访问与管理Oracle数据库。 主要用于开发学习的64-bit Oracle Data Provider for .NET 4版本为12.2.0.1.0;64-bit Oracle Data Provider for .NET 2.0 版本同样为12.2.0.1.0;此外,还有64-bit Oracle Providers for ASP.NET 4和ASP.NET 2.0的相同版本号。另外提供的是64-bit Oracle Provider for OLE DB以及64-bit Oracle Services for Microsoft Transaction Server,两者均采用同一版本标识:12.2.0.1.0。最后提及的是Oracle Instant Client,其对应的版本也是12.2.0.1.0。